The first Newcastle United friendly of pre-season ended Newcastle 4 Carlisle 0.

The behind closed doors Saturday match was played at United’s training ground.

A big bonus to see that amongst those involved were Joelinton and Sven Botman, who both missed the end of last season through injury.

Indeed, the Brazil international getting one of the goals, with Sean Longstaff, Ben Parkinson and Jacob Murphy getting the other three.

Only seven days now until the first of the six pre-season friendlies to be played in front of supporters, with 10,000+ Newcastle United fans heading up to Celtic.

Just five weeks now until the season kicks off at Aston Villa.

‘Goals from Sean Longstaff, Joelinton, Jacob Murphy and Ben Parkinson helped Newcastle United kick off their 2025/26 pre-season campaign with a behind-closed-doors victory over Carlisle United.

The Cumbrians, managed by Mark Hughes, visited the Magpies’ Training Centre for the friendly, which allowed Eddie Howe’s side to step up their preparations for the season ahead after they returned to training earlier in the week.

Both teams fielded different XIs in each half and Longstaff – who had been denied by Gabriel Breeze early on – opened the scoring midway through the first period with a spectacular, swerving long-range strike.

With new signing Anthony Elanga watching his new team-mates hours after his move from Nottingham Forest was completed on Friday night, Nick Pope kept out an Elliot Embleton free kick before Joe Willock fired wide after a strong burst into the box.

In the opening exchanges of the second half, a neat move saw Jacob Murphy play in Harvey Barnes, but his shot was kept out by Harry Lewis.

Then the same two players combined, with Murphy’s teasing cross from the right headed wide by Barnes.

But Joelinton scored the hosts’ second of the afternoon when he won possession from a reaction press high up the pitch, then slotted home.

And Murphy made it three, rounding the goalkeeper and a couple of defenders following Barnes’ cutback.

Young forward Parkinson rounded off the scoring when he impressively flicked on to Barnes, who switched play to Murphy, with Parkinson improvising to backheel the ensuing cross into the net.

It made for an encouraging start to pre-season for the Magpies, whose next test sees them take on Celtic in seven days’ time.

Newcastle United (first half): Nick Pope, Kieran Trippier, Jamaal Lascelles, William Osula, Joe Willock, Sean Longstaff, Alex Murphy, Lewis Miley, Trevan Sanusi, Leo Shahar, Sean Neave

Newcastle United (second half): John Ruddy, Sven Botman, Fabian Schär, Joelinton, Harvey Barnes, Matt Targett, Jacob Murphy, Joe White, Harrison Ashby, Ben Parkinson, Travis Hernes

The six announced public Newcastle United friendlies announced so far:

Saturday 19 July – Celtic v Newcastle

Sunday 27 July – Arsenal v Newcastle (In Singapore)

Wednesday 30 July – Team K-League all stars v Newcastle (In South Korea)

Sunday 3 August – Tottenham v Newcastle (In South Korea)

Friday 8 August – Newcastle v Espanyol (St James’ Park)
